What are IATA and ICAO Airport Codes?
IATA (International Air Transport Association) and ICAO (International Civil Aviation Organization) airport codes are unique identifiers assigned to airports around the world. IATA codes are three-letter codes commonly used by airlines and travel agents for ticketing and baggage handling. ICAO codes are four-letter codes used for air traffic control and flight planning. For example, Washington Dulles International airport has IATA code IAD and ICAO code KIAD.
